* Also match QJSValue conversion types in MatchScore.Michael Bruning2016-04-201-0/+2
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| This had the effect that overloaded methods were always mapped to the wrong slot. [ChangeLog][QtQml][Important Behavior Changes] When matching the method signature of a invokable method to the slot in the metaobject, the matching function now assigns the best match to a QJSValue if the parameter actually is a QJSValue. This corrects the previous behavior, where QJSValue and int were given the same match score even though QJSValue would have been the best match. * Occasionally trim the type cacheUlf Hermann2016-04-192-1/+21
| | | | | | | | | | | | As loaded components are kept in a cache, they are never removed by the garbage collector. So, if you periodically create new components, they leak. This change adds a floating threshold for the number of components. When that threshold is surpassed trimCache() is called and unneeded components are removed. * QQmlDesignerMetaObject: Fixing reference countingThomas Hartmann2016-04-181-7/+10
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| We have to overwrite the cache of QQmlInterceptorMetaObject, but we messed up the reference counting. The same applies for QQmlData. When overwriting the old cache we have to call release on the old cache and increase the reference count on the new cache, because it is released in the destructors of QmlData and QQmlInterceptorMetaObject.
